The TMA Minnesota Chapter is excited to have Ross Widmoyer - President & CEO of the Faribault Mill Company speak at our luncheon/program on August 17th.
Ross will share the impressive story of the Faribault Mill, which first opened in 1865. After it closed its doors in 2009 following an attempted restructuring, the mill re-opened in 2011 after the Mooty cousins Chuck and Paul, purchased Faribault Woolen Mill. They reinvigorated the brand and marketing - effectively becoming a 158-year-old startup.
The mill continues to operate today as Faribault Mill under the company slogan “The return to American excellence” and serves as a shining example of a great turnaround in Minnesota.

FACT: The Faribault Woolen Mill Company's building was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 2012 for having state-level significance in the theme of industry. It was nominated for being one of the largest and oldest fully integrated woolen mills in Minnesota.
